What's It For?
Trail shoes are great for light weight and mobility but
particularly on loose, dusty terrain, bits of stone, rock, grit and
dust tend to find their way over the cuff of the shoe meaning
periodic removal and emptying. The Debris Sock is an all-in-one
solution combining a well padded merino wool - or CoolMax - sock with
a gaiter that fastens over the cuff of the shoe, effectively sealing
the opening against loose stuff.
The Techy Bits
The sock bit of the Debris Sock is an anatomically padded merino
unit with loops stitching along the underside of the foot and heel,
though not over the top of the foot.

The really clever bit though is the gaiter which hooks onto the
laces at the front of the shoe and uses a replaceable fastener which
runs under the sole unit to hold it in place. The fasten is held by
Velcro tabs making it easy to replace or simply to don and remove the
sock.
How It Performs
We reckon dry, summer Peak District conditions will be just the
job for the Debris Sock and a quick trial outing suggests that it
works well with a good fit on some TNF running shoes effectively
keeping the crap out of the shoe over a two-hour yomp across some
loose trails.

We're a little concerned about the long-term durability of the
underfoot fastener, but it's replaceable and fine so far as long as
you position it carefully. In extremis, you could always bodge some
sort of wire-based alternative. Additionally, with some sole units,
there's no clear channel to run the fastener along, so it tends to
work better with blocky soles like the ones Inov8 themselves use.
Finally, the merino sock bits are nicely padded, albeit a bit warm
for pure summer use. The CoolMax Debris Sock 38 might be a better
option if you're a hot-footed sort of person.
There are separate gaiter units out there, but the Debris Sock
is an elegant all-in-one solution to grit ingress that's also -
because it's fabric based - very breathable too. We started off
thinking it was a bit Heath Robinson, but it does actually do the
job, though it works better with some sole units than others.

We suspect that very fine grit will still work its way through the
knit of the fabric cuff, but you won't have to deal with the larger
particles that cause real discomfort and stops. Looking good so far,
we'll carry on using them and report back.
